Output d29c16b7f7fcd2bfaeb3e89eed3c023fa201aa752ec4fcb9098fb21400bc95e6:1

value
8556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bfdf265fc55fac68bd56777ea8053c13f91b12 OP_EQUAL
address
3JXt7KRqZfMFyrWRbgC9gMxT449xrmLbcv
transaction
d29c16b7f7fcd2bfaeb3e89eed3c023fa201aa752ec4fcb9098fb21400bc95e6
confirmations
141670
spent
true